Homeowners in New Hampshire often face a wide range of costs when replacing a leach field. The price varies by soil conditions, system size, and local permit rules. The primary cost drivers are soil tests, trench length, septic tank access, and regulatory requirements in NH communities.

Cost awareness helps homeowners plan a budget and compare quotes for leach field replacement in New Hampshire.

Item Low Average High Notes
Total Project $8,000 $14,000 $25,000 Assumes typical drain field replacement with new dosing and trenching
Per Sq Ft Drain Field $8 $15 $25 Depends on trench depth and soil type
Permits & Fees $500 $2,000 $4,000 Municipal plus state requirements in NH
Labor $3,000 $6,000 $12,000 Hours, crew size, and terrain influence
Materials $2,000 $4,000 $7,000 Soil media, piping, filters, risers
Equipment & Excavation $1,000 $3,000 $6,000 Backhoe, compaction, testing tools
Delivery / Disposal $500 $1,500 $3,000 Soil disposal and disposal fees
Contingency $1,000 $2,000 $4,000 Unforeseen soil or rock conditions

Pricing Components

Costs split into site preparation, trenching length, and system design. Site prep includes removing vegetation and addressing drainage around the replacement area. Trench length increases with the required drain field area and soil depth. System design factors include septic tank size, anticipated effluent load, and setback requirements in NH towns.

Factors That Affect Price

The price is driven by soil type, drain field area, and regulatory requirements. In NH, steeper slopes or rocky soils raise excavation time and equipment needs. A larger septic tank or additional features such as filtration beds add to cost. Local permit complexity and contractor availability also shape the estimate.

Ways To Save

Ask for a detailed bid with a line item breakdown to spot potential savings. Consider evaluating a slightly smaller drain field if soil tests permit, or combining the replacement with minor drainage improvements. Scheduling work in NH during shoulder seasons can reduce labor rates when demand is lower. Compare at least three bidders to understand regional pricing variations.

Regional Price Differences

New England pricing can vary by state and county. In three NH locales, material and labor may shift by up to 12 percent due to regulatory nuance and supplier proximity. Urban areas typically have higher disposal fees and permit costs, while rural zones may incur longer travel times for crews.
